URGENT: LA Landlords Accused of Illegally Raising Rents Amid Wildfire Crisis

Jason Oppenheim alleges that some Los Angeles property managers are exploiting wildfire emergency conditions by charging exorbitant rents over allowed limits. Officials promise swift enforcement to stop these illegal hikes.
